CPA firms located outside Ohio may practice public accounting on an incidental/temporary basis without obtaining an Ohio firm registration. Ohio does not register public accounting firms based in another state. Public accounting firms in other states that open an Ohio office do need to register as Ohio public accounting firms. The average amount you’ve been charged for a conversion from your ad. Average cost per action (CPA) is calculated by dividing the total cost of conversions by the total number of conversions. For example, if your ad receives 2 conversions, one costing $2.00 and one costing $4.00, your average CPA for those conversions ...Average cost per action (CPA) is calculated by dividing the total cost of conversions by the total number of conversions. For example, if your ad receives 2 conversions, one costing $2.00 and one costing $4.00, your average CPA for those conversions is $3.00. CPA, 2019 includes e-commerce as a new service under the statute. Accountingverse.com. Accounting is commonly known as the "language of business". It is a means through which information about a business entity is communicated. Through the financial statements – the end-product reports in accounting – it delivers information to different users to help them in making decisions.
